Title: MA Numbers
Post by: Grimm on June 17, 2002, 10:29:26 AM
I was up and watching the number of feilds quiet abit last night.  I saw the numbers also.

The thing I noticed and Iv seen this before was the flow to the winning side.

Last night the Rooks nearly had the reset, The Knights and Rooks tied.   It looked like the rooks were going to do it.   Then in a short time, the Rooks numbers grew.   The Bishops seemed to lessen along with the Knights.

Then the Knights lost a feild to the Bishops, and the Rooks had to fight the flank.   The Bishops got  a rook field.   Then the tide of battle started to swing toward the Knights.  

As the Knights took the lead, I watch Rook number drop, Bishop hold pretty steady and Knights swell.  

My Conclusion was some guys must be jumping countries to gain the reset perks.    I dont really know if its true or holds water, but It sure appeared that way.   Beside, its their $15 and they can play as they choose.  

I did find the flow of numbers pretty interesting.  

I dont know if the Knight won the reset, but I do they seemed to be on the ball last night.   ::Salute::

A salute to my rook country men that fought bravely and well.
